American Seafoods Company is a leader in harvesting, at-sea processing, and supply of wild-caught, sustainable seafood, primarily from the fisheries of Alaska. They operate a fleet of state-of-the-art vessels and are committed to responsible fishing practices, resource management, and providing high-quality seafood products like pollock, cod, and hake to customers worldwide. Their operations are centered on sustainable fishing in U.S. waters of the North Pacific Ocean and the Bering Sea.

American Seafoods primarily conducts its harvesting and at-sea processing operations in U.S. waters, specifically the North Pacific Ocean, Bering Sea, and Aleutian Islands (for species like pollock and Pacific hake/whiting) and the Northwest Atlantic Ocean (for sea scallops). While its fishing operations are domestic, its high-quality, frozen-at-sea seafood products are marketed and distributed globally, serving customers across North America, Asia, and Europe. The company's global reach is therefore primarily through its sales, marketing, and distribution networks that supply international food markets.

Undercurrent News • January 10, 2024
American Seafoods confirmed the sale of its last longline cod catcher-processor, the F/T Northern Jaeger, to a Russian fishing company. This move marks the company's exit from the U.S. Pacific cod freezer longline fishery, allowing it to concentrate on its core pollock and hake operations....more
PR Newswire • August 1, 2023
Private equity firm Bregal Partners announced the successful completion of its acquisition of American Seafoods Group LLC, a prominent leader in the harvesting, at-sea processing, and distribution of wild-caught seafood. The partnership aims to support American Seafoods' long-term growth and sustainability initiatives....more
